Cómo instalar Ruby en CentOS/RHEL 7/6

Cómo instalar Ruby en CentOS/RHEL 7/6

Cómo instalar Ruby en CentOS/RHEL 7/6 . Ruby es un lenguaje de programación dinámico y orientado a objetos centrado en la simplicidad y la productividad. RVM (Ruby Version Manager) es una herramienta para instalar y administrar múltiples versiones de Ruby en sistemas operativos únicos. Este tutorial lo ayudará a instalar RVM en su sistema. Después de eso, instale el último Ruby en los sistemas CentOS y Redhat utilizando RVM.

Paso 1 - Instalación de requisitos

En primer lugar, debe instalar todos los paquetes requeridos para la instalación de Ruby en nuestro sistema utilizando el siguiente comando.

yum instalación GCC-C ++ Patch Readline Readline-devel Zlib Zlib-devel Libffi-devel \ Openssl-devel Make BZIP2 Autoconf Autoconf Libtool Bison Sqlite-Devel 

Paso 2 - Instale RVM

Ahora, instale la última versión estable de RVM en su sistema utilizando el siguiente comando. Este comando descargará automáticamente todos los archivos requeridos e instalará en su sistema.

curl -ssl https: // rvm.io/mpapis.ASC | gpg2 --import -curl -ssl https: // rvm.io/pkuczynski.ASC | GPG2 -Import - 

Después de eso, instale la última versión de RVM estable en su sistema.

curl -l get.RVM.IO | bash -s estable 

Una vez que terminó la instalación, ejecute el comando a continuación para cargar el entorno RVM.

fuente /etc /perfil.d/rvm.SH RVM Recargar 

Paso 3: verificar las dependencias

Ahora use el siguiente comando para verificar que todas las dependencias estén instaladas correctamente. Esto instalará cualquier dependencia faltante en su sistema.

Requisitos de RVM ejecutados Verificación de requisitos para CentOS. Instalación de requisitos exitoso. 

Paso 4 - Instale Ruby en Centos

Ahora, su sistema está listo para la instalación de Ruby. Puede encontrar la versión de Ruby disponible para la instalación utilizando el siguiente comando.

Lista de RVM conocida 

Luego instale la versión Ruby requerida en su sistema. Aquí, estoy instalando Ruby 2.7 en mi sistema CentOS. Simplemente puede reemplazar la versión a continuación del comando de su elección e instalar.

RVM Instalar 2.7 

Paso 5 - Configuración de la versión Ruby predeterminada

En primer lugar, verifique las versiones Ruby instaladas actualmente en su sistema. Para que podamos encontrar qué versión está utilizando actualmente por el sistema y cuál está configurado como predeterminado.

lista de rvm  Ruby-2.4.4 [x86_64] * Ruby-2.5.1 [x86_64] => Ruby-2.7.0 [x86_64] # => - actual # = * - actual && default # * - predeterminado 

Después de eso, use el comando RVM para configurar la versión Ruby predeterminada que se utilizará por aplicaciones.

RVM usa 2.7 --default usando/usr/local/rvm/gems/ruby-2.7.0 

Paso 6 - Verifique la versión Ruby Active

Usando el siguiente comando, puede verificar la versión Ruby actualmente activa.

Ruby -Versión Ruby 2.7.0p0 (2019-12-25 Revisión 647EE6F091) [x86_64-linux] 

Felicitaciones, finalmente ha instalado con éxito Ruby en su sistema. Lea nuestros próximos artículos para implementar Ruby con Apache o Ruby con Nginx Web Server con simples pasos.

Referencias:
1. http: // rvm.io/rubíes/instalación